The Shanghai Masters 1000 was known as one of the fastest courts tournaments on the ATP tour and it is no coincidence that it was much loved by powerful players from the baseline, but the situation has changed lately. The organizers of the penultimate Masters 1000 of the season have decided to slow down the surface and the first complaints have emerged, with insiders and fans wondering the reason behind this strange choice.

The last player to blastthe courts of Shanghai was World No.4Taylor Fritz, who had to work hard to beat Hungarian player Fabian Marozsan on his debut. The American ace who didn't have much time to get used to these conditions having reached the final in Tokyo earlier this week prevailed in the decisive tiebreak and was very tired at the end of the clash, before expressing all his frustration during his press conference.

Fritz is not happy

"The court is incredibly slow," Fritz confided without any hesitation. "For me it is a really negative change and I don't understand the reason for this choice by the organizers. Last year the courts were quite fast, while the balls were slow, so the situation was positive from my point of view. The surface was not too slow in the last edition. However, the organizers have decided to slow down the camps this year. The balls remained quite slow and become huge after a few games, not forgetting the humidity that makes the conditions even tougher. The game is significantly slowed down in this way, it seems that the ball does not move forward" concluded Taylor.

He had achieved excellent results in the last part of the 2024 season, including the semifinal at the Shanghai Masters 1000. Fritz had been defeated by Serbian legend Novak Djokovic here a year ago, before reaching the final at the Nitto ATP Finals in Turin. The American star will try to do better again this year, but it will not be easy to express his potential to the fullest on such a slow surface.
